bus from Cliffside Park, NJ to Port Authority, NY
We bought a house in Cliffside Park near the Supermarket on Edgewater Rd & Anderson Ave...what is the best/fasted/nearest buses available in the area to commute to Manhattans Port Authority?
Also, does anyone know the cost of a monthly pass?
Any advice would be great!

Express buses stop on gorge rd, by the little triangular park, across from the library. About 25-35 min to PA

sorry, she takes 156R or 159R in the morning, going home same Bus leaves at gate 201 or 202 in Port Auth.
165 is going to Oradell, never mind
